You begin your journey in Dead Sails with the default class, The Nothing Role. To switch to a new class, head to the class store, which is highlighted in purple, and participate in the spinning mechanic. There are two types of spins available: Regular and Lucky. The Regular Spin costs 3 Dabloons per attempt, while the Lucky Spin, which can be purchased separately, offers significantly better odds.

Regular Spin

  • Common: 62.5%
  • Rare: 30.25%
  • Epic: 7%
  • Legendary: 0.25%

Lucky Spin

  • Rare: 30.25%
  • Epic: 64.75%
  • Legendary: 5%

Be aware that the odds for spinning in Dead Sails can be challenging, often seeming tougher than stated. For this reason, we recommend that new players save up at least 250 Dabloons before attempting to spin for Epic and Legendary classes, as it may require a significant daily grind.

Common Classes Tier List

**Class Name****Class Buffs****Why This Tier?**
**Pirate**Boat speed is increased by 20mp/h.The Pirate is **B-Tier** and ranks as the 2nd best starting class due to its highly beneficial speed boost, which is useful throughout the entire game.
**Miner**Spawns with dynamite.The Miner is **D-Tier** because dynamite is a situational and often underwhelming weapon.

Rare Classes Tier List

**Class Name****Class Buffs****Why This Tier?**
**Gunslinger**Spawns with a random gun and ammo.The Gunslinger falls into **C-Tier**. While it's better than nothing, it's hardly worth spending your Dabloons on.
**Medic**Spawns with additional heals.The Medic is **C-Tier** because the additional healing packs, while helpful, are not as essential as they might seem.

Epic Class Tier List

**Class Name****Class Buffs****Why This Tier?**
**Priest**Spawns with 3 crosses and 1 holy water.The Priest is **A-Tier** and likely the best class in terms of cost-effectiveness. With multiple Priests in a group, they can be devastating in both combat and cash generation.

Legendary Classes Tier List

**Class Name****Class Buffs****Why This Tier?**
**Screw Loose**Has more stamina and better speed.The Screw Loose is **B-Tier**. Surprisingly, stamina and speed are less crucial than you might think at the start of the game.
**Rich**Starts with more cash and valuable items.The Rich class is **S-Tier** because, just like in real life, having more cash opens many doors.
**Pyromaniac**Turns anything into fuel, including junk and other items.The Pyromaniac is **A-Tier**, though it could be **B-Tier** depending on your play style. We rank it as A because it saves a lot of time.
**Necromancer**Revives and recruits the mobs you kill.The Necromancer is **S-Tier** because it is arguably the most powerful class in the game.
**Trader**Sells items for a higher price.The Trader is **A-Tier** due to the substantial amount of money it can generate over time.
**Sheriff**Gets a powerful weapon right from the start.The Sheriff is **A-Tier** because starting with a powerful weapon is a significant advantage, though not essential for overall success.
